BRIGHTON, Mich., Oct. 3 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Encore Energy Systems, Inc. (Other OTC: ENCS), a rapidly growing diversified energy company today announce a new Strategic Partner for its Florida and Caribbean expansions. The company's new partner is Aircorps, Florida. http://www.airxpressonline.com/ Aircorps is a Florida State Certified Class "A" Air Conditioning Contractor that performs commercial HVAC contracting in an unlimited capacity/tonnage throughout the state of Florida. Aircorps sister company, Air Xpress is also a state registered Certified Class A Air Conditioning Contractor that performs all phases of residential air conditioning throughout Pasco, Pinellas, Hillsborough and Hernando counties. Aircorps and Air Xpress will perform as our exclusive contractors handling all the engineering and installation work for Encore's business in the state of Florida and where applicable, throughout the Bahamas and the Caribbean. The cost of electricity in the Bahamas and Caribbean region is typically priced at or above $0.25c per KWh, 5 to 10 times higher than the USA. In addition to its direct commercial expansion into this market, Encore and Aircorps will present a detailed report to government representatives on methods to reduce the load on the local power grids. Our solutions provide a rapid return on investment compared to the domestic USA market when geothermal cooling systems are measured against traditional systems. About the Company Encore Energy Systems grows through energy-related acquisitions, marketing its patented geothermal water-air heating/cooling systems, and sales of energy conservation solutions. The company's patented DeMarco Energy Miser heat pumps have been installed in Oregon, Pennsylvania, Washington, Montana, South Dakota, Mississippi, California and Texas. Encore's primary focus is to provide energy efficient technologies to commercial and institutional markets that result in significant energy and cost savings.
